Pegar uma list de um outro pacote e método

3 respostas
jkrfabio

Meu método que terá que trazer a list:

public List<String> getListValorPorDataNascimento(String dataNascimento) {
		
		return null;
	}

E aqui está minha list:

public List<JSONObject> getPorIdade(String data) {
		List<JSONObject> result = new ArrayList<JSONObject>();

		Cursor cursor = db.rawQuery(SELECT_VALORES + " where idade = " + data
				+ ";", null);

		cursor.moveToFirst();
		while (!cursor.isAfterLast()) {
			JSONObject a = readRow(cursor);
			result.add(a);
			cursor.moveToNext();
		}

		cursor.close();
		return result;
	}

Como faço para pegar esta minha lista pelo meu primeiro método? Pois preciso tratá-la depois naquele método.

3 Respostas

nel

Sabe o que são objetos em Java ?
Você sabe instanciar uma classe ?

São perguntas simples, mas senão souber isso, recomendo fortemente a ler o básico do Java que você resolve isso facilmente.

jkrfabio

nel:
Sabe o que são objetos em Java ?
Você sabe instanciar uma classe ?

São perguntas simples, mas senão souber isso, recomendo fortemente a ler o básico do Java que você resolve isso facilmente.

public List<String> getListValorPorDataNascimento(String dataNascimento) {
		
		TabelaService a = new TabelaService();
		a.getPorIdade(dataNascimento);
		
		return a.getListValorPorDataNascimento(dataNascimento);
	}

Assim?

nel

jkrfabio:
nel:
Sabe o que são objetos em Java ?
Você sabe instanciar uma classe ?

São perguntas simples, mas senão souber isso, recomendo fortemente a ler o básico do Java que você resolve isso facilmente.

public List<String> getListValorPorDataNascimento(String dataNascimento) {
		
		TabelaService a = new TabelaService();
		a.getPorIdade(dataNascimento);
		
		return a.getListValorPorDataNascimento(dataNascimento);
	}

Assim?

Se o método estiver na classe ‘TabelaService’ sim, assim mesmo. Já testou ? :slight_smile:

Criado 19 de março de 2013
Ultima resposta 19 de mar. de 2013
Respostas 3
Participantes 2